    Tail length is a good indicator of him being part/full MC so is how you describe his coat & length,his weight is also more than you would expect from a domestic cat of that age,not all MC's have the long thick lynx tips I have one who has next to nothing but have also one who although he had thin but longish tips as a babe has now got super thick ones,appeared when he was about four,the same one has also gone from having small tufts between his toes to very hairy & ideal for dipping in water & sucking off of & he has silky long snowshoes to die for,the best out of all my MC's so the answer to do tufts grow thicker with age is yes.....
